Residence Inn By Marriott Portland Vancouver
45.61855, -122.54518Located around 7 km from Henry J. Kaiser Shipyard Memorial, the 3-star Residence Inn By Marriott Portland Vancouver offers Wi-Fi throughout the property and a car park. Boasting an indoor pool, this Vancouver hotel is nestled at a distance of 4.2 km from natural attractions like Pacific Community Park.
Location
You'll need 15-minute drive to Portland International airport. The hotel is at a distance of 4.3 km from Cascades Volcano Observatory in Vancouver. This Vancouver property is also within close distance of Tom Mccall Waterfront Park. The nearby entertainment attractions of Vancouver include AMC CLASSIC Mill Plain 8 Movie Theater, which is approximately 10 minutes' walk away.
Well-connected to many sights, the accommodation is a minute's walk from Southeast Mill Plain Boulevard & Southeast 123rd Avenue bus stop.

missingWrote a review on 13 Septspacious suitehome-like comfortoverly bright lighting
The suite features a spacious layout, perfect for stretching out after a long day. The kitchen is stocked with real dishes, which adds a nice touch of home-like comfort during the stay.
The bathroom lighting is so intensely bright it could wake the dead, making late-night trips a painful experience. Additionally, the clock by the bedside had the wrong time and was tricky to adjust. it buzzed annoyingly when I accidentally turned on the alarm setting. The ambient lighting throughout the suite could use improvement, as it felt dim and uninviting in areas like the living room and kitchen.
